April 28, 200816 yr SP3 went final on the 21st, leaked to the masses on the 22nd. since the 21st there have been 3 SP3 releases floating around:1) a bogus one pieced together by the release group "Zero Waiting Time"2) one signed by microsoft and confirmed to be SP3 RTM, but only downloadable from a 3rd-party site3) a second one signed by microsoft and confirmed to be RTM, downloadable from microsoft's own websitethe MD5 hashes from #2 and #3 match up, but #3 adds the piece of mind of knowing you downloaded directly from microsoft. btw, the link that Dark_Knignt put up is for #3 :dancing:
